(Rome = Yonhap News) Correspondent Jeon Seong-hoon =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ky is scheduled to deliver a video speech to Italian parliamentarians on the 22nd (local time).

According to the ANSA news agency, President Zelensky is scheduled to deliver a message to Italian lawmakers via video at 11 a.m. that day.

Italy’s senators and parliamentarians will gather at the Houses of Parliament in Rome to see President Zelensky, and Prime Minister Mario Draghi is also expected to attend.

In this speech, President Zelensky is expected to reiterate his determination to resist the war and appeal for additional support from Western countries, including Italy.

Prior to this, President Zelensky gave video speeches to Congresses in the United States, Britain, Canada and Germany.

Recently, the Ukrainian government reportedly asked the Japanese parliament to allow President Zelensky to make a video speech.
